如何使用MySQL Binlog Digger工具进行数据恢复?请结合实际案例说明其使用流程。
时间: 2024-10-26 10:10:49 浏览: 43
为了帮助你理解并掌握MySQL Binlog Digger的使用方法,以下是结合实际案例的使用流程说明,针对你当前的问题:如何使用MySQL Binlog Digger工具进行数据恢复?
参考资源链接:[MySQL Binlog Digger 4.8.0:数据恢复利器](https://wenku.csdn.net/doc/64534d71ea0840391e7795d3?spm=1055.2569.3001.10343)
首先,确保你已经下载了《MySQL Binlog Digger 4.8.0:数据恢复利器》这份资料,它将为你提供全面的操作指南和实用技巧。
1. 安装和启动MySQL Binlog Digger。由于版本4.8.0无需安装,直接解压后即可运行,你可以通过双击启动程序或使用命令行启动。
2. 连接到MySQL数据库。在程序启动后,你需要输入数据库的连接信息,包括主机名、端口、用户名和密码。点击“测试连接”确保一切设置正确无误。
3. 选择binlog文件并设置时间范围。在确认连接成功后,选择你想要分析的binlog文件。你可以根据误操作的时间点来设置时间范围,以便缩小搜索范围。
4. 选择SQL类型并进行过滤。根据你的需要,选择要显示的SQL语句类型(redo SQL或undo SQL),并使用过滤功能来精确定位到误操作的SQL语句。
5. 分析binlog并生成SQL语句。点击“开始挖掘”后,工具将分析选中的binlog文件,并列出相应的SQL语句。你可以预览SQL语句,并根据需要进行导出或保存操作。
6. 执行SQL语句进行数据恢复。在生成了所需SQL语句后,你可以将这些语句导入MySQL数据库执行。对于undo SQL语句,执行后将回滚到误操作之前的状态;对于redo SQL语句,执行后可以重做之前的操作。
7. 验证数据恢复结果。在执行完SQL语句后,回到数据库中检查数据是否已经正确恢复,确保所有数据与误操作前保持一致。
通过上述步骤,你可以有效地使用MySQL Binlog Digger进行数据恢复。为了进一步提升你的技能,建议详细阅读《MySQL Binlog Digger 4.8.0:数据恢复利器》中的高级用法和最佳实践,这将帮助你在数据恢复工作中更加得心应手。
如果你希望在实践中更深入地了解如何进行数据恢复,以及如何应对复杂的误操作情况,这份资料将为你提供详细的操作指南和实用技巧,确保你能安全、高效地完成数据恢复任务。
参考资源链接:[MySQL Binlog Digger 4.8.0:数据恢复利器](https://wenku.csdn.net/doc/64534d71ea0840391e7795d3?spm=1055.2569.3001.10343)
阅读全文